Gunshots fired in Montreal’s Griffintown

Shots were fired late Sunday night in Griffintown.
Montreal Police (SPVM) say officers were alerted around 11 p.m. after reports of gunshots heard on Young Street, near William Street.

Officers did not locate any victims or possible suspects when they arrived on the scene. However, shell casings were found on the ground.
Investigators, assisted by forensic identification technicians, worked overnight to analyze evidence and determine the circumstances surrounding the incident.

The SPVM K9 unit was also deployed to assist in the search for additional evidence, while witnesses were interviewed by police.
Investigators are expected to review surveillance camera footage from the area that may have captured the shooting.
No arrests have been made and no suspects have been identified so far.
